    36、on engines operating under transient conditions Part 11: Test-bed measurement of gaseous and particulate exhaust emissions from engines used in nonroad mobile machinery under transient test conditions BS ISO 8178-11:2006 vii Introduction Todays measurement systems depend on the type of test cycle, s

    37、teady state or transient, and the type of pollutant to be measured. On a steady state cycle, the mass of gaseous emissions can be calculated either from the concentration in the raw exhaust gas and the exhaust flow of the engine, which can easily be determined, or from the concentration in the dilut

    38、ed exhaust gas and the CVS (Constant Volume Sampling) flow of a full flow dilution system. Both equivalent systems are described in ISO 8178-1. For PM, full flow dilution or partial flow dilution systems, in which only a portion of the exhaust gas is diluted, can be used. On a transient cycle as cov

    39、ered by this International Standard, real-time exhaust flow determination is more difficult. Therefore, the CVS principle has been used for many years due to the fact that exhaust mass flow measurement is not required with this system. The total exhaust gas is diluted, the total flow as the sum of d

    40、ilution air and exhaust gas flow is kept virtually constant and the emissions (gaseous and PM) are measured in the diluted exhaust gas. The space and cost requirements of such a system are considerably higher than for the partial flow dilution systems used on steady state cycles. On the other hand,

    41、raw exhaust measurement and partial flow systems can only be applied to transients if sophisticated control systems and calculation algorithms are used. For most nonroad applications and heavy-duty engines, the CVS system is large and costly. Therefore, ISO 16183 has been developed by ISO/TC 22/SC 5

    42、, which defines raw gaseous emissions measurement and partial flow dilution for heavy-duty engines under transient test conditions. Since many nonroad engines are similar to heavy-duty engines in engine size, displacement and power, it is believed that the contents of ISO 16183 can also be applied t

    43、o nonroad engines. For the purpose of this International Standard, both full flow dilution and partial flow dilution/raw exhaust methods are considered equivalent and are therefore covered herein.     44、11: Test-bed measurement of gaseous and particulate exhaust emissions from engines used in nonroad mobile machinery under transient test conditions 1 Scope This part of ISO 8178 specifies the measurement and evaluation methods for gaseous and particulate exhaust emission from reciprocating internal

    45、combustion (RIC) engines under transient conditions on a test bed, necessary for determining one value for each exhaust gas pollutant. The specific transient test cycle covered by this part of ISO 8178 is applicable to compression-ignition engines for mobile use with a power output between 37 kW and

    46、 560 kW, excluding engines for motor vehicles primarily designed for road use. This part of ISO 8178 may be applied to engines used in off-road vehicles and diesel powered off-road industrial equipment as described in 8.3.1.3 of ISO 8178-4. This includes e.g. engines for construction equipment inclu

    47、ding wheel loaders, bulldozers, crawler tractors, crawler loaders, truck-type loaders, off-highway trucks, hydraulic excavators, agricultural equipment, self propelled agricultural vehicles (including tractors), forestry equipment, fork lift trucks, road maintenance equipment and mobile cranes. Many

    48、 of the procedures described below are detailed accounts of laboratory methods, since determining an emissions value requires performing a complex set of individual measurements, rather than obtaining a single measured value. Thus, the results obtained depend as much on the process of performing the

    49、 measurements as they depend on the engine and test method. 2 Normative references The following referenced documents are indispensable for the application of this document.
